Slots with freespins and multipliers: how to extract the maximum


1) Why this particular type of bonus is strong

The multiplier (×) scales each payout in the freespins, and at progression (growth behind the cascades/backs) strengthens the "right tail" of the results.
Synergy with cascades/ways/clusters: more small matches → faster multiplier increases → higher chance of a major outcome.
Retriggers increase the duration of the bonus and the likelihood of reaching large ×.

2) Basic metrics: What to really count

BF (Bonus Frequency) - average spin to bonus.
ABP (Average Bonus Payout) - average bonus payout in bets (xBet).
EV of spin bonus: $ext {EV} _ b\approx\frac {ext {ABP}} {ext {BF}} $ in xBet/spin.
Where RTP "sits": if a significant share is laid in the freespins, the base will be "tougher" - you need a bank supply.

Practice (500-1000 spin demo): Count BF, ABP and approximate $ext {EV} _ b $. Compare slots/modes (with and without Ante).

3) Option choice in freespins: more spins vs starting multiplier

In many games, the options try to equalize in average EV, but the risk profile is different.

More spins (low/moderate profile):
  • There is a higher chance of catching retriggers/cascades, "rocking" the progression.
  • Flatter curve, more often average results.
  • - Below is the chance of a super-big hit for a short bonus.

High start factor (high volatility):
  • Above P (≥N×) with successful early matches.
  • - In short, the bonus → more often "past," more zero/small outcomes.

Selection heuristic:
  • Small bank, the goal is to stably "not sawn" → longer spins.
  • Hunting for x500 + and there is a margin of variance → above the starting factor.
  • If you see strong retryggers and a "multiplier ladder" behind the cascades, more often more spins are more profitable.

4) Ante Bet and Bonus Buy

Ante Bet / Double Chance

Increases the chance of a trigger, but increases the cost of spin; RTP can grow or not (see "i").
Test A/B: 300-500 spins without Ante and with Ante → compare BF and approximate $ext {EV} _ b $. If RTP has not grown, Ante is about pace, not profit.

Bonus Buy

Immediately gives freespins for a fixed price (usually 50-150 × rates and higher).
The variance is growing sharply: you need a series of purchases and a smaller "unit of risk."
Check RTP bonus purchases (may differ from the base game).

5) How multiplier mechanics affect strategy

Progressive multiplier for cascades: value increases with bonus length → choose more spins/retriggers; keep the rate lower (volatility higher).
Sticky/Expanding Wild with a multiplier: powerful "sticks" make the profile sharp → the rate is 0.5-1% of the bank, the stop loss is wider.
Flip factors (roaming/mixing on lines): above the chance of random hits → you can increase the pace, but with stop rules.
Global × for all wins (not per line): less dependence on a specific grid → the profile is softer with the same backs.

9) Frequent errors in slots with freespins and multipliers

Enable Ante "by default" without checking RTP and BF.
Raising the rate "since there was no bonus for a long time" is a myth about the "debt" of the slot.
Choose "fewer spins/more ×" without a bank for high dispersion.
Cut lines instead of rate cut/line.
Draw conclusions on 100-200 backs/2-3 bonuses - you need a series.
